Key Ceremony Checklist — Item 12 (Stillmere Publishing, Pagewright builder)

[ ] After rotating the signing key, trigger an incremental static site rebuild rather than a full rebuild; only pages touched since the last manifest should regenerate. Verify the manifest hash matches, then unseal the ceremony vault using the recovery passphrase recorded directly below this item.

strongbox words: alddor-rusius-belox-gorys-holius-oliix-ralmir-lamvan-briius-fraion-zormir-novwyn-zormir-holmir

## Authentication

Hey on-call — if the Cartwheel checkout load test pages you, don't panic: the Burrowlane harness hammers staging every Tuesday night. Before poking at anything, you'll need to auth against the harness control API to pause or dial down the run. Tokens are short-lived (4h), so grab a fresh one if yours stales out. For this rotation, the control API key is below.

API key for yahig-tadup: kto7_ubizbYm

### Step 4: Wire up the parcel webhook

Welcome aboard! The Trundleport tracking service POSTs scan events to our `/hooks/parcel` endpoint. Point it at your local tunnel for testing — the sandbox retries failed deliveries every 90 seconds, so don't panic at duplicates. The handler verifies each payload with a shared signing secret, which goes in your env file on the line below.

secret setting of hawep-yahig: LEDGER_TOKEN29=41b5d6315371c92885eaeb077fb63

**Q: My plugin keeps losing its websocket connection to the Corvana gateway. Is this the known reconnect bug?**

Likely yes. Versions 2.3 through 2.5 of the Corvana client library fail to re-subscribe channels after an automatic reconnect, so the socket appears healthy but receives no events. Upgrade to 2.6 or later, which restores subscriptions on reconnect. If you still see silent drops after upgrading, include your client version and gateway region and write to us at the address below.

alerts address for yajof-kahog: eliax@qirvanlabs.corp

**Q: How do I get into the hardware lab?**

A: The Birchway hardware lab on Level 4 is restricted to trained staff. First, complete the ESD safety module and have your line manager approve lab access in the Quillon portal. Approval usually takes one working day. Until your badge is provisioned, the lab door accepts the interim entry code below.

staff pass of tagef-kawif = bdg-CD-0